I haven't looked in the Cygwin FAQ specifically for this, but the need for the
cygipc package is described in /usr/doc/Cygwin/postgresql-7.1.3.README. It
seems, though, that people don't seem to know about /usr/doc. You can find the
answers to quite a few questions there!

> > Just my 2ct - but could it be you did not start ipc-daemon? It's not in the
> > standard
> > cygwin distrib (one should bang the heads of these guys - to distribute a
> > program
> > and not even mentioning (e.g in the postinstall scripts) that you need to
> > get cygipc
> > from somewhere else!).
> > 
> > Just search for cygipc on the net - I use 1.11 (I think), and it works
> > fine. Without
> > ipc-daemon running in the bg, you get exactly the reported behaviour!
